Braves' Peterson scratched night after game-ending HR (Yahoo Sports)

Atlanta Braves center fielder Jace Peterson (8) is seen to by interim manager Brian Snitker (43) after hitting the wall while catching a fly ball off the bat of Washington Nationals' Chris Heisey during the third inning of a baseball game, Sunday, Aug. 21, 2016, in Atlanta. (AP Photo/John Amis)

Jace Peterson has been scratched from the Atlanta Braves' lineup due to general soreness a day after crashing into the outfield wall and later hitting a game-ending homer . Peterson stayed in Sunday's game after running shoulder-first into the wall in center during the third inning to make a catch. Peterson was initially listed in Monday's lineup against the Arizona Diamondbacks batting seventh and playing second base, but he was replaced by Chase d'Arnaud.
